Why does my dog keep licking her lips

A dog can smack its lips when anticipating food, when thirsty or dehydrated, anxious, suffering from acid reflux, nausea, a type of seizure, or after ingesting poison. 1. Anticipation of Food. When dogs see and smell food, they start salivating and licking their lips. It’s common behavior when dogs anticipate food.

May 25, 2021 · For this reason, it is often considered that lip licking is more likely associated with some gastrointestinal disorder or discomfort. One particular study sought to investigate this. Dogs demonstrating excessive licking behaviour were studied. In 14 of 19 licking dogs, gastrointestinal abnormalities were noted. If you ha...Jan 22, 2024 · Another possible reason a dog may excessively lick its lips is an underlying health issue. Nausea, oral pain, seizures, and allergies can all cause lip licking. 1. Nausea. Nausea often precedes vomiting. A nauseous dog will lick its lips, appear restless and apprehensive, salivate, and repeatedly swallow. Behavioral Reasons That Cause Your Dog to Lick. Boredom and or anxiousness. Calming or soothing effects (licking releases endorphins that make your pet feel good) Developed bad habits.
